Commit graph

517 commits

Author SHA1 Message Date
8131f054b5
vps-private: Enable karakeep 2026-02-10 19:19:33 +01:00
d676c79d58
laptop: Rename wlan network 2026-02-08 13:39:40 +01:00
a9b26c8198
Move modules alloy and atuin from web-services to services 2026-02-07 22:28:48 +01:00
c64820af7f
vps-private: Enable atuin server 2026-02-07 21:46:35 +01:00
066a8e624f
nebula: Fix malformed groups in the certificates 2026-02-05 23:50:06 +01:00
dfdabfb5b1
nebula: Switch to group-based firewall rules 2026-02-05 23:32:52 +01:00
f1e10f728e
syncthing: Read device id from file by default 2026-02-04 17:53:05 +01:00
100f02a2d8
profiles: Introduce core, server and workstation profiles 2026-02-03 21:09:06 +01:00
5c61459fe7
Enable comin on remaining servers 2026-02-03 18:42:12 +01:00
9bcbe7e031
Install btop everywhere 2026-02-03 18:38:36 +01:00
16b8bbf076
vps-private: Enable comin 2026-02-03 18:31:51 +01:00
277dd188ae
vps-private: Disable memos 2026-02-01 22:52:11 +01:00
6d5a9538a7
vps-private: Disable freshrss 2026-01-31 19:32:10 +01:00
feaf941082
desktop: Remove redundant option 2026-01-31 02:04:36 +01:00
a14692c6d6
nebula: Auto enable as default overlay implementation 2026-01-31 01:53:30 +01:00
27b5c57023
networking: Unify underlay config across hosts 2026-01-30 20:39:59 +01:00
8e949b0361
Rename module gc to auto-gc 2026-01-23 21:32:41 +01:00
4039f12871
vps-monitor: Don't monitor public dav domain with gatus 2026-01-22 22:42:54 +01:00
edfc766b46
vps-public: Enable networking-toolbox 2026-01-22 22:25:11 +01:00
cfa3792d93
vps-public: Enable screego 2026-01-22 21:35:13 +01:00
b487ec8ae7
Remove meta.ports and meta.domains modules 2026-01-21 23:25:16 +01:00
581241e860
vps-monitor: Fix variable name 2026-01-20 08:53:44 +01:00
ca35081ddc
vps-monitor: Expose ntfy completely publicly again 2026-01-19 21:34:31 +01:00
4ddc49c001
gatus: Include the whole domain in the endpoint name 2026-01-17 22:01:09 +01:00
9299842ce0
vps-monitor: Only allow writes to ntfy over vpn 2026-01-15 22:21:25 +01:00
d73e3744a8
vps-public: Only allow access to radicale's login page over vpn 2026-01-15 22:20:48 +01:00
7b8435a555
Expose radicale publicly 2026-01-14 21:06:58 +01:00
f3ad654ad3
vps-public: Remove unneeded crowdsec secret 2026-01-12 20:59:32 +01:00
2ae08dc9c5
grafana: Enable datasources and dashboards intelligently 2026-01-12 20:57:16 +01:00
81a08c60a0
vps-monitor: Disable grafana's crowdsec dashboard 2026-01-12 20:38:15 +01:00
55c0eb01be
Expose ntfy publicly 2026-01-12 01:42:30 +01:00
b1a827580d
vps-public: Disable crowdsec 2026-01-12 00:57:33 +01:00
79da1f6644
vps-*: Fix nebula option name 2026-01-11 21:33:00 +01:00
2b5bc47384
laptop: Fix dns by enabling networkd 2026-01-11 19:14:40 +01:00
252abe9443
Create networking abstraction on top of nebula 2026-01-11 19:13:30 +01:00
6804112df6
Disable any ipv6 functionality 2026-01-11 14:34:53 +01:00
3cf75dc7e1
Remove all traces of tailscale 2026-01-11 00:17:51 +01:00
ccac4395a2
Finally disable tailscale on clients 2026-01-11 00:10:08 +01:00
2acd61d67e
vps-monitor: Switch completely to nebula 2026-01-11 00:07:24 +01:00
6069bd4b06
vps-public: Switch completely to nebula 2026-01-10 23:27:36 +01:00
b7a2598ebe
vps-private: Switch completely to nebula 2026-01-10 23:25:13 +01:00
c6b56d87ff
gc: Enable on servers with gcroot cleanup only 2026-01-10 14:37:44 +01:00
ac3b43a952
nebula: Add DNS support by configuring unbound 2026-01-09 19:43:19 +01:00
dc3fc4d5ad
Enable localsend on clients 2026-01-09 16:15:31 +01:00
1c61682e5a
tailscale: Disable ssh for all hosts 2026-01-07 20:51:50 +01:00
ef6cdd8e22
nebula: Roll out to all hosts 2026-01-06 21:33:46 +01:00
61f5c54196
nebula: Enable firewall and restrict ssh access by role 2026-01-03 00:41:13 +01:00
94ac7bbca3
vps-public: Disable forgejo's ssh server 2025-12-31 19:19:04 +01:00
02846ab16f
Refactor web services to use a unified web-services namespace 2025-12-28 19:33:56 +01:00
308ee43ec4
vps-public: Disable stirling-pdf 2025-12-28 19:12:08 +01:00